Another thing, and as odd as it may sound - we've found over the years that surfers seem to enjoy behind-the-scene pics of stuff like prop-building and set construction. We've gotten a lot of feedback on short storyboard sets that illustrate things we build or scenes we set up for photoshoots.
Again, comparing it to a backstage pass - I guess its akin to having the chance to see how the sound system works...or how the stage rigging is handled. Gives them that feeling of being among the groupies and seeing stuff most people don't.
